package com.sun.faces.application.annotation;
import com.sun.faces.util.Util;
import java.lang.annotation.Annotation;
import java.lang.reflect.Field;
import java.lang.reflect.Method;
import java.util.ArrayList;
import javax.persistence.PersistenceContext;
/**
* Scanner
implementation responsible for {@link PersistenceContext} annotations.
*/
class PersistenceContextScanner implements Scanner {
/**
* Get the annotation we handle.
*
* @return the annotation we handle.
*/
@Override
public Class getAnnotation() {
return PersistenceContext.class;
}
/**
* Scan the specified class for the given annotation.
*
* @param clazz the class.
* @return the runtime annotation handler.
* @todo Make sure we get all the fields, handle method and class based injection, handle PersistenceContexts.
*/
@Override
public RuntimeAnnotationHandler scan(Class clazz) {
Util.notNull("clazz", clazz);
PersistenceContextHandler handler = null;
ArrayList fieldAnnotations = new ArrayList<>();
ArrayList fields = new ArrayList<>();
for (Field field : clazz.getDeclaredFields()) {
PersistenceContext fieldAnnotation = field.getAnnotation(PersistenceContext.class);
if (fieldAnnotation != null) {
fieldAnnotations.add(fieldAnnotation);
fields.add(field);
}
}
ArrayList methodAnnotations = new ArrayList<>();
ArrayList methods = new ArrayList<>();
for (Method method : clazz.getDeclaredMethods()) {
PersistenceContext methodAnnotation = method.getAnnotation(PersistenceContext.class);
if (methodAnnotation != null) {
methodAnnotations.add(methodAnnotation);
methods.add(method);
}
}
if (!fieldAnnotations.isEmpty() || !methodAnnotations.isEmpty()) {
handler = new PersistenceContextHandler(
methods.toArray(new Method[0]), methodAnnotations.toArray(new PersistenceContext[0]),
fields.toArray(new Field[0]), fieldAnnotations.toArray(new PersistenceContext[0]));
}
return handler;
}
}
